Sunset of MobileAd and MobileImageAd Ad Types

Starting June 2015, AdWords will no longer support WAP mobile ads for devices without a full-featured browser, including feature phones. At that time, the AdWords API will no longer support creation of new MobileAds or MobileImageAds. Any remaining ads with these types will stop serving and be converted into DeprecatedAds with status REMOVED. These changes will be visible in all supported versions of the API, though the DeprecatedAd.type field may be UNKNOWN until it can be added to the WSDL in a subsequent API release.

Historical performance metrics for any removed ads will still be available for download via the API’s AD_PERFORMANCE_REPORT.

Next steps
To reach the broadest set of mobile users with your campaigns, we recommend that you:
  • Recreate your ad in a non-WAP mobile ad format: Once you've created your ad in one of our new mobile-specific formats, you can drive more mobile traffic to your ads by setting mobile-specific bid adjustments. If you'd like to keep a copy of your original WAP mobile ads and their performance metrics, we recommend that you download reports for your original WAP mobile ad groups before June 1, 2015.
  • For Display Network-only campaigns: You can create mobile-preferred ads to target specific mobile platforms and mobile carriers for a campaign.
